Steven Knight, renowned for his work on British period dramas like Peaky Blinders, has released a new series titled House of Guinness, which is being hailed as one of his best. Cast member James Norton praised the script as 'Steven at his absolute best.' The series, which has been ranked number 1 in Glossary Magazine's list of captivating period dramas, centers on the Guinness family following the death of patriarch Sir Benjamin Guinness. It delves into the lives of his four adult children—Arthur, Edward, Anne, and Ben—as they navigate the challenges of running the world's largest brewery amidst personal and familial conflicts. Norton's character, Sean Rafferty, is a lapsed Catholic from Dublin who becomes entwined with the Guinness family, facing his own struggles with love and ambition. The narrative unfolds against the rich backdrop of 19th-century Dublin and New York, showcasing the complex dynamics within the family and the brewery's operations.
